BOXABL (BXBL) Joins Nasdaq Following SPAC Merger Approval, Bringing Factory-Built Housing Model to Public Markets
BOXABL (BXBL) began trading on Nasdaq after a SPAC merger, valued at $3.5 billion with 350 million shares at $10 each. The company has raised over $230 million and produced 800 modular homes, expanding into residential, multifamily, and commercial housing. Management plans to grow production and diversify offerings. The company became public through a merger with FG Merger II Corp, with risks including volatility and dilution.
